32 подводных камня OpenMP при программировании на C++
От: Аноним  
Дата: 26.08.08 14:44
Оценка: 470 (7) +1 :)
Статья:
32 подводных камня OpenMP при программировании на C++
Автор(ы): Алексей Колосов, Евгений Рыжков, Андрей Карпов
Дата: 26.08.2008
С распространением многоядерных систем задача параллельного программирования становится все более и более актуальной. Данная область, однако, является новой даже для большинства опытных программистов.
Существующие компиляторы и анализаторы кода позволяют находить некоторые ошибки, возникающие при разработке параллельного кода. Многие ошибки никак не диагностируются. В данной статье приводится описание ряда ошибок, приводящих к некорректному поведению параллельных программ, созданных на основе технологии OpenMP.


Авторы:
Analytic2007

Аннотация:
С распространением многоядерных систем задача параллельного программирования становится все более и более актуальной. Данная область, однако, является новой даже для большинства опытных программистов.
Существующие компиляторы и анализаторы кода позволяют находить некоторые ошибки, возникающие при разработке параллельного кода. Многие ошибки никак не диагностируются. В данной статье приводится описание ряда ошибок, приводящих к некорректному поведению параллельных программ, созданных на основе технологии OpenMP.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.